Automotive Silver Pastes Market - Global Forecast 2026-2032

The Automotive Silver Pastes Market size was estimated at USD 2.84 billion in 2025 and expected to reach USD 3.10 billion in 2026, at a CAGR of 8.58% to reach USD 5.06 billion by 2032.

Exploring the critical role of automotive silver pastes in powering next-generation vehicle electronics through superior conductivity reliability and compatibility with evolving manufacturing processes

In the contemporary automotive landscape, electrical and electronic systems have become integral to vehicle performance, safety, and user experience. Silver pastes serve as the conductive backbone in printed wiring boards and semiconductor packages, delivering unparalleled electrical and thermal conductivity essential for high-reliability applications. These formulations support the dense circuitry of advanced electronic control units, enabling rapid signal transmission and efficient heat dissipation. Furthermore, silver pastes adapt to a wide range of substrates, from ceramics to polymers, maintaining robust performance under harsh vibration and temperature cycling conditions. As automotive manufacturers integrate more sophisticated subsystems, the demand for materials that withstand rigorous operational environments has intensified.

Moreover, the shift toward electrified powertrains has elevated the importance of conductive adhesives and inks in battery management systems and power modules. Electric vehicles rely on silver paste technology to interconnect cells, manage thermal loads, and maintain consistent electrical performance over extensive lifecycles. Simultaneously, regulatory pressures and sustainability initiatives have prompted a transition toward formulations with reduced volatile organic compound emissions and compatibility with green manufacturing. Consequently, silver paste providers are innovating binder chemistries and curing processes to meet these evolving needs. As a result, automotive silver pastes have emerged as a foundational technology, underpinning the next generation of connected, autonomous, and electrified vehicles while satisfying stringent reliability and environmental requirements.

Analyzing the pivotal shifts reshaping the automotive conductive materials landscape driven by widespread electrification advanced miniaturization sensor integration and sustainability targets

The automotive conductive materials landscape is undergoing profound transformations as electrification accelerates across vehicle segments. The transition to electric and hybrid powertrains has spurred demand for silver paste formulations capable of withstanding higher voltages and thermal stresses. Enhanced thermal management requirements in power electronics have prompted innovations in heat-dissipative paste chemistries, enabling efficient cooling of inverters and converters. At the same time, the miniaturization of electronic components to support sophisticated driver assistance and infotainment systems has challenged paste manufacturers to achieve finer line widths and improved print resolution. This precision is essential for surface mount processes that dominate modern circuit assembly lines.

In parallel, the proliferation of sensors for functions such as collision avoidance, battery monitoring, and cabin environmental control has elevated the role of silver pastes in sensor fabrication. Paste formulations now need to balance electrical conductivity with mechanical flexibility to maintain signal integrity under repetitive stress. Sustainability imperatives have additionally driven the adoption of low-temperature curing and alternative chemistries that reduce energy consumption and environmental impact. Innovations in ultraviolet and laser curing techniques have shortened processing cycles and expanded substrate compatibility. Consequently, the combined influence of electrification, miniaturization, sensor integration, and sustainability has reshaped performance benchmarks, compelling material developers and automotive manufacturers to collaborate more closely to co-develop solutions aligned with the industry’s evolving requirements.

Evaluating the cumulative impact of United States tariffs implemented in 2025 on automotive silver paste supply chains material costs and strategic procurement practices

In early 2025, the United States government introduced new tariff measures targeting key raw materials and chemical imports integral to the manufacture of automotive silver pastes. These tariffs increased landed costs for silver powders, solvent carriers, and specialized resin components, placing pressure on margins across the value chain. Many paste producers responded by exploring alternative procurement strategies, including diversifying supplier bases and negotiating long-term supply contracts to secure favorable pricing. The imposition of duties has also catalyzed interest in domestic production of critical feedstocks, with several manufacturers announcing plans to localize binder and solvent production to mitigate exposure to international trade volatility.

As a result, automotive OEMs and tier one suppliers have re-evaluated their sourcing models, emphasizing risk management alongside cost efficiency. Collaborative agreements between material developers and automotive firms have expanded to include joint development of formulations that reduce reliance on tariff-sensitive ingredients. Moreover, the increased cost of ownership has driven material utilization innovations, with assembly operations optimizing deposit volumes and exploring hybrid conductor architectures combining silver paste with alternative metallic interconnects. During this period, companies have also begun to implement digital traceability solutions to monitor raw material provenance and dynamically adjust procurement strategies as tariff conditions evolve. These adaptations highlight the industry’s commitment to sustaining operational continuity while preserving a competitive edge under a protectionist trade regime.

Uncovering nuanced insights across automotive silver paste market segmentation based on application binder type curing method form and packaging preferences

The diversity of automotive silver paste applications necessitates a nuanced approach to segmentation, recognizing that each end use imposes distinct performance and processing requirements. In electronic control units, which encompass body control modules, engine management systems, infotainment hubs, safety control subsystems, and transmission interfaces, paste formulations must prioritize thermal conductivity and mechanical robustness to ensure consistent signal integrity over millions of operational cycles. Lighting applications, spanning dashboard illumination, headlamps, interior accent lighting, and taillamps, demand not only high electrical conductivity but also compatibility with varied substrate geometries and resistance to ultraviolet exposure. Power module segments, including direct current–direct current converters, inverter units, and motor controllers, exert extreme thermal and current density stresses, driving the evolution of cream pastes optimized for rapid heat dissipation and electrical stability. Sensor domains, covering position, pressure, and temperature detection, require paste compositions that maintain stable conductivity while accommodating movement and vibration without degradation.

Beyond application-based distinctions, binder chemistry serves as a crucial differentiator. Acrylic systems cure rapidly with strong adhesion on polymer substrates; epoxy matrices deliver chemical resistance and mechanical strength; and silicone binders provide flexibility and thermal shock tolerance for dynamic components. Curing methods further shape production workflows: laser processes enable localized heating, thermal ovens deliver batch uniformity, and ultraviolet systems offer rapid polymerization with lower energy requirements. Form considerations introduce environmental dimensions, as solvent-based dispersions ensure broad substrate compatibility while water-based formulations support tighter emissions compliance. Finally, packaging in cartridges facilitates automated dispensing in high-volume assembly, and syringes enable precision application in specialized operations. This layered segmentation highlights the specificity required for optimal performance across automotive electronic applications.

Delving into regional nuances shaping automotive silver paste adoption across Americas Europe Middle East Africa and Asia Pacific automotive manufacturing hubs

Across the Americas, automotive clusters in the United States, Canada, and Mexico have prioritized integrating silver paste technologies into electric vehicle power electronics and advanced driver assistance systems. U.S. manufacturers leverage domestic production and regulatory incentives to drive innovation in high-conductivity, low-emission paste formulations, while Mexican assembly operations are increasingly sourcing materials locally to ensure supply chain continuity. In South America, early-stage electrification programs have begun to adopt paste chemistries tailored to regional infrastructure and economic considerations.

In Europe, stringent environmental frameworks and circular economy initiatives compel paste developers to produce recyclable and low-VOC formulations for a range of electronic control and lighting applications. OEMs across the continent demand advanced materials that support autonomous functions and energy-efficient lighting. The Middle East’s expanding vehicle assembly hubs are exploring partnerships to establish local conductive material production, while Africa’s automotive sector, though nascent, is gradually incorporating high-reliability silver pastes in commercial vehicle applications.

The Asia-Pacific region remains the largest consumer and innovator in automotive conductives, driven by China, Japan, South Korea, and Taiwan. High-volume manufacturing and dedicated R&D funding have fostered collaborative development of paste systems optimized for electric drivetrains and sensor modules. Simultaneously, Southeast Asian assembly centers are scaling up production lines equipped with precision dispensing solutions, reflecting the region’s growing role in global automotive electronics manufacturing. Collectively, these regional distinctions underscore the need for tailored paste solutions that reconcile global performance standards with local manufacturing realities.

Highlighting leading companies driving innovation and competitive dynamics in the automotive silver paste landscape through advanced materials research strategic alliances and global manufacturing capabilities

A cohort of specialized materials companies commands the forefront of automotive silver paste innovation, each leveraging unique technological strengths and global footprints to secure competitive advantage. Renowned multinational firms have amplified their research endeavors in low-temperature and UV-curable paste formulations, addressing the accelerated production cycles and sustainability mandates of modern vehicle assembly. Strategic alliances between global paste producers and semiconductor fabricators have yielded bespoke conductor chemistries, fine-tuned for high-volume surface mount applications in power electronics and sensor modules. Concurrently, several industry leaders have pursued acquisitions to enhance their material science portfolios, incorporating specialized binder technologies and complementary additive solutions to broaden their product offerings.

Operationally, these companies have undertaken capacity expansions in high-growth regions, aligning manufacturing with increasing local demand for conductive materials. Joint ventures with regional suppliers facilitate streamlined access to raw silver sources, while vertical integration efforts aim to stabilize material input costs amidst trade uncertainties. Leading paste providers have integrated digital monitoring and quality analytics to ensure consistency across dispersed facilities. Collaborative research programs with automotive OEMs have fostered co-development of high-reliability paste systems, enabling accelerated validation cycles and seamless incorporation into emerging electric, autonomous, and connected vehicle platforms. Through these multifaceted strategies, key market participants continue to define competitive dynamics and lay the groundwork for next-generation conductive materials within the automotive sector.
